US further eases Iran sanctions after nuclear deal
The Obama administration is further easing sanctions on Iran, making it easier for foreign firms to do business with the country following last year’s nuclear deal.

Shell and BP testing water to resume commercial engagement with Iran
British oil expert Chris Cook said that Shell and BP are testing water to resume full commercial engagement with the Islamic Republic.

Iran bearing heavy costs in fight against drug traffickers: UN envoy
As the frontrunner of the fight against illegal drug traffickers, Iran sustained huge life and property losses in its fight against the “merchants of death, a senior Iranian diplomat said before a UN General Assembly committee on October 6.
